I have a few questions:
1. Has any solo developer released Open Source Software (OSS) and then been better off for it?
a) there are numerous stories of OSS devs who have been so frustrated that they later yanked their software and caused great tumult
2. Why would any solo developer ever release their software as OSS?
Debunked Myth Hasn't Proliferated Yet
The only answer I can come up with is "They think they will be helped along by the generosity of those who use their software". But that myth has been debunked. People don't donate actual $$.
If you don't believe this, watch this video of Bruno Lowagie of iText fame (text to PDF conversion) and all of his struggles. Creating OSS is actually exasperating.
Open Source Survival: A Story from the Trenches - YouTube[^] The video is long but I watched it at 1.5x speed.
Linus & Linux?
Ok, I'll give you this one, Linus seems to have done ok, but can you name any others who have really succeeded?
When you release your software as OSS you can't actually profit from others using it.
You can only profit by charging for documentation or support or other on-the-side things.
That means only huge companies who can build huge support structures can really make money.
That means no single dev could ever really do that.
I'm pretty sure OSS is now just a way for large companies to use developer's solutions without ever having to pay them.
